Univision uses its mighty radio and TV group to push green-card holders toward citizenship.
April 14, 2007
According to Inside Radio magazine, the thinking is that those new citizens – perhaps millions of them – will become voters who can influence the issue of immigration. It’s the kind of move that a public company probably wouldn’t make — but a newly privately-held Univision can feel free to do.
